"Editors are usually wealthy," the man with the sample" case remarked." "Yes," I aaid, "they are familiar with all tho slang and business phrases of the money market; they -write about millions a3 ordinary men talk about dollars; they build railroads; they or ganize mining and magnificent trans portation companies, with fabulous capitol; thoy declare war without con sulting the Rothschilds, and if all the banks in Amerioa were to fail to-morrow they wouldn't be a cent poorer than they are to-day. Yes, they are rich. They associate vith the mon eyed classes, they sit down at tho ta ble with kings, sometimes; in happier, luckier moments, with aces; it j'ou want to borrow money, go to the editor; he will turn to his advertising columns and tell vou where you can borrow it. I you have money to loan, rather than see you suffer, he will borrow it himself. Rich! Ho knows the sooret of the moneyed rings; ho divulges the plans and8chemes of the heavy opera tors to tho people; he roars himself louder than the bulls, and growls among the bears; his voice is heard in tho temple of the money changers, asking for money; he warble3 his little roundelay out on tho curbstone, in melancholy minor key, when ho does not get it Oh, yes, editors are rich. When you want to spend all the money you have in tho wide world, go to your lawyer; when you want something done for nothing, hie to your news paper office. Then, when you want to send some man to congrc S3, send your lawyer, because you cannot got along without him." I paused, and an im pressive, profound silence filled the car like a dream of peace. I looked around upon my audience. It was asleep. Bob Burdett. IIow to Slake a Speech. Hon.
